The World of Vodka: A Brief Introduction

Vodka, one of the world’s most popular alcoholic beverages, is made by distilling fermented grains or potatoes. Often consumed neat, it also serves as a versatile ingredient in cocktails. The cost of vodka varies depending on factors like brand, quality, and location.

How Much Does a Half Gallon of Vodka Cost?

A half-gallon of vodka typically costs around $30, with prices varying depending on the brand, quality, and where it’s purchased. Some popular vodka brands and their approximate half-gallon prices include:

  • Smirnoff: $25
  • Absolut: $40
  • Grey Goose: $60
  • Tito’s Handmade Vodka: $35

Vodka Brand Spotlight: Tito’s and Absolut

Tito’s Handmade Vodka, founded by Bert “Tito” Beveridge II in 1997, claims to be the first legal micro-distillery in Texas since Prohibition. Tito’s is made from yellow corn rather than wheat or potatoes, resulting in a smooth vodka with a unique flavor profile.

Absolut Vodka, on the other hand, is a Swedish brand known for its rich, full-bodied, smooth, and mellow flavors. Absolut’s range is free of artificial colors and flavorings, and the brand is committed to sustainability, with 40% of its bottles made from recycled glass.

How Much Vodka is Too Much?

The amount of vodka consumed can have varying effects on individuals. Drinking two to four shots might provide a pleasant buzz, while five to nine shots may result in extreme drunkenness. Consuming over ten shots is likely to lead to extreme intoxication, which can be dangerous. To enjoy vodka responsibly, it is essential to consume in moderation and be aware of personal limits.

A Look at Vodka Consumption: How Many Shots are in a Half Gallon?

A half-gallon of vodka contains approximately 39 shots, allowing for multiple servings and making it a cost-effective option for parties or gatherings. However, it is crucial to drink responsibly and avoid overconsumption.

The Impact of Location on Vodka Prices

Vodka prices can vary significantly depending on where you live in the United States. For example, Grey Goose vodka may be more expensive in California, while Skyy Vodka could be cheaper in Texas. This variation in pricing is often due to factors like taxes and local economic conditions.
